NMIMS CET Syllabus 2026
| Subjects | Topics |
|---|---|
| Physics | Physics and measurement, Kinematics, Thermodynamics, Work, energy, and power, Rotational Motion, Gravitation, Laws of motion, Properties of solids and liquids, Electronic devices, Kinetic theory of gases, Oscillations and waves, Current electricity, Magnetic effects of current and magnetism, Electromagnetic induction and alternating currents, electromagnetic waves, Optics, Electrostatics |
| Chemistry | Physical chemistry: Some basic concepts in chemistry, states of matter, Atomic structure, Chemical bonding molecular structure, Chemical thermodynamics, Solutions, equilibrium, Redox reactions and electrochemistry, Chemical kinetics, Organic chemistry: Purification and characterization of organic compounds, Hydrocarbons, Chemistry in everyday life, Principles related to practical chemistry, Organic compounds containing halogens, oxygen, and nitrogen, Polymers Inorganic Chemistry: Classification of elements and periodicity in properties, Block elements (alkali and alkaline earth metals), P Block elements (group-13 to group-18 elements, d- and f-block elements), Coordination compounds, Environmental chemistry, General principles and processes of isolation of metals |
| Mathematics | Sets and functions, Complex number and quadratic equation, Matrices and determinants, Permutation and combination, Mathematical induction, Binomial theorem and its application, Sequence and series, Limit, continuity and differentiability, Integral calculus, Coordinate geometry, Three-dimensional geometry, Vector algebra, Statistics and probability, Trigonometry |
| Critical Thinking | Decision making, Problem-solving, Logical intelligence, Verbal-logical reasoning, Numerical reasoning, Venn diagram, Mathematical equalities, Data interpretation, Graphs and charts |
| Language Proficiency | Error recognition, Recognising grammatical structure and usage, Applied grammar – Using prepositions, determiners, connectives, tenses appropriately etc, Contextual usage, Sequencing of ideas, Reading comprehension Passages – Locating Information, grasping ideas, identifying relationships, interpreting ideas, moods, characteristics of characters, tone of the passage, inferring, getting the central theme, evaluating |

NMIMS CET Exam Pattern 2026
NMIMS CET exam pattern 2026 has been released. Through NMIMS CET pattern, candidates can know more details on how authorities will conduct entrance examination. Some important information available through NMIMS CET 2026 exam pattern are examination mode, duration, section, marking scheme and more. According to official pattern, NMIMS CET 2026 will be held as a computer based test.
| Particulars | Details |
|---|---|
| Mode | Computer Based Test |
| Duration | 2 hours |
| Type of Questions | Objective Multiple-Choice Questions |
| Sections | Physics, Chemistry, Mathematics/Biology, Logical Intelligence, Verbal Reasoning |
| Total Number of Questions | 120 |
| Marking Scheme | 1 mark for every correct answer. No negative marking |
